Ethereum RWAs Pass $15B as Liquid Staking ETP Launches in Europe

-

The market for Ethereum-based real-world assets (RWAs) has surpassed $15 billion in total market capitalization, a nearly 200% increase from the previous year. Separately, WisdomTree has launched Europe’s first fully staked Ethereum exchange-traded product (ETP), which stakes 100% of its assets to deliver full staking rewards to investors through a liquid staking model.


The total market capitalization for Ethereum real-world assets has exceeded $15 billion, according to data from Token Terminal. This represents a nearly 200% year-on-year increase and signals growing institutional adoption of blockchain for traditional finance products.

On February 16, WisdomTree Funds launched the WisdomTree Physical Lido Staked Ether ETP (LIST). It is traded on several major European exchanges including Deutsche Börse Xetra and SIX Swiss Exchange.

Unlike traditional Ethereum ETPs, LIST stakes 100% of its underlying assets via Lido Finance. This structure allows investors to earn the full Ethereum staking yield while maintaining liquidity through tradable stETH tokens.

The product utilizes liquid staking to simplify complex operational and risk management tasks. It mitigates validator risk and avoids the 71-day entry queue for Ethereum’s validator set.

Kean Gilbert, Head of Institutional Relations at Lido, stated that this solution taps into the most capital-efficient source of yield in crypto while simplifying operations for institutional clients. The regulatory environment in Europe enabled this first-of-its-kind product for total returns.
